TRP channels are cation channels linked to pain notion and thermosensation [forty seven]. TRPV1 is activated by a lot of stimuli, which includes heat (>forty two °C), vanilloids, lipids, and protons/cations. Various hugely selective TRPV1 antagonists are now in scientific advancement for that treatment method of pain. Although the usage of desensitizing TRPV1 agonists lowers pain sensitivity [48,49], latest clinical trials have revealed that blocking TRPV1 also has an effect on human body temperature. This unlucky aspect effect has halted A great deal of the drug advancement action concentrating on this channel. Topical application, having said that, is shown to become efficient in proleviate helps block pain receptors blocking the initial pain flare-up that happens with agonist-induced nociceptor excitation previous to desensitization. TRPM8 is activated in vitro by cold temperatures (ten–23 °C) and cooling agents which include icilin and menthol. Researchers have recently disclosed which the TRPM8 antagonist fifteen produces an analgesic effect in experimental models of chilly pain in people without having impacting Main physique temperature [50].
